Crab Grilled Cheese

Heavenly Crab Grilled Cheese to Elevate Your Comfort Food Game

This Crab Grilled Cheese takes comfort food to new heights with rich flavors and delicious crab meat.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 8 minutes
Total Time 23 minutes
Servings: 2 sandwiches
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: American
Calories: 540

Ingredients
  

For the Filling
  • 8 oz Crab Meat fresh or canned
  • 2 Tbsp Mayonnaise
  • 1 Tbsp Dijon Mustard
  • 1 tsp Old Bay Seasoning
  • 1 tsp Pepper optional
  • 2 Tbsp Green Onions chopped
For the Cheese
  • 4 oz Gruyere Cheese shredded
  • 4 oz Cheddar Cheese shredded
For the Bread
  • 4 slices Sourdough Bread or white/whole grain
  • 2 Tbsp Butter or olive oil

Equipment

  • Frying pan

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. In a medium bowl, combine the crab meat, m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, Old Bay seasoning, black pepper, and chopped green onions. Gently fold these ingredients to keep the crab chunky.
  2. In a separate bowl, mix together the Gruyere and Cheddar cheese until well combined.
  3. Take two slices of sourdough bread, sprinkle Gruyere on each, then spread half of the crab mixture on one and top with Cheddar cheese before placing the other slice on top.
  4. In a skillet, melt one tablespoon of butter over medium heat. Cook the sandwich for 3-4 minutes until golden brown and crispy.
  5. Flip the sandwich, add remaining butter, and cook for another 3-4 minutes until the second side is golden brown and cheeses are melted.
  6. Remove the sandwich from the skillet, let cool for a minute, then cut in half and serve warm.

Notes

For best results, use fresh crab meat and keep the cooking temperature at medium for even toasting.
